The police officers watching Woojin and Kim Cheolung frowned and their eyes widened.
Because they couldn’t even imagine an ordinary officer looking indifferent in front of Assemblyman Lee.
Woojin’s calm expression even seemed like annoyance to them.
Given the brief conversation between them, it was highly likely they knew each other,
“Shin Woojin, aren’t you going to be polite in front of the Assemblyman?”
When someone said that, Woojin saluted Kim Cheolung.
“Salute, Officer Shin Woojin.”
Kim Cheolung smiled and saluted playfully.
“Salute.”
A faint smile formed on Woojin’s lips.
The meaning of ‘return’ was, of course, because Assemblyman Kim Cheolung had arrived.
Woojin spoke, maintaining a faint smile.
“But Assemblyman Kim Cheolung, isn’t this an abuse of authority? I was working.”
The police officers were speechless at Woojin’s bold manner towards the Assemblyman.
They merely wore expressions as if to say, ‘Is this guy crazy?’
Kim Cheolung, on the other hand, shook his head.
He’s truly an unchanging friend. But he could tell that Woojin was welcoming him.
The faint smile he wore was proof.
His tone of voice also conveyed that feeling.
Kim Cheolung shouted, as if bursting out.
“Yes! You rascal, I came here to abuse my authority!”
Then he looked at the police officers.
“Is it alright if I borrow this friend for a moment?”
One of them, briefly surprised, said,
“Oh! Of course. Shin Woojin, serve the Assemblyman well!”
Woojin checked his wristwatch and said,
“There’s still an hour left of work.”
One police officer quickly approached Woojin and whispered,
“Go. Quickly. Do you want to see us all get screwed? Go quickly. Quickly.”
“The documents aren’t finished yet.”
“I’ll do it for you, just go quickly.”
“These are matters I need to handle myself…”
At Woojin’s question, he wanted to shout out in frustration, feeling as if a heavy stone had rolled into his chest, but he once again composed himself and whispered,
“Hey, go quickly. Think of this as work and go. Quickly.”
Woojin nodded as if he had no choice.
“Alright.”
Just then, the police officers’ walkie-talkies rang.
-Situation concluded. We will transport the criminal immediately. Is Officer Shin Woojin alright? Even if he says he’s fine, he should probably go to the hospital.
“Why Woojin? What are you talking about?”
-Didn’t you say Officer Shin Woojin was cut by a knife?
“What? What are you saying?”
-Officer Shin Woojin was cut by a knife while apprehending the criminal.
At that moment, Woojin spoke up.
“It was scary, but I’m fine. It’s just a slight scratch.”
Suddenly, Prosecutor Kim Cheolung pushed up his glasses.
“An officer bravely fought and apprehended a criminal with a knife. Isn’t this grounds for a special promotion?”
Those who had been stunned by the news coming through the walkie-talkie, seemed to come to their senses and said,
“Yes…? Of course!”
“Woojin, are you really okay?”
“Yes. I’m fine.”
Kim Cheolung slung his arm over Woojin’s shoulder and said,
“Let’s head out for now.”

The place where Woojin and Kim Cheolung were sitting was a Pork Belly restaurant.
Woojin, holding the tongs, was grilling the pork belly until it was golden brown.
It looked truly delicious.
“Here, have a drink.”
“Just a moment. Let me just cut this…”
Woojin cut the pork belly with a snip, as if performing a cutting ceremony.
Their glasses were filled, and they raised them to toast.
Kim Cheolung bit into a chili pepper as a snack and said,
“You’re really amazing. Catching criminals left and right in the four-room, eight-room area. They’ll run out of them. They’ll run out.”
Woojin refilled his glass and asked,
“How have you been?”
“Me? Oh, just bickering and fighting with thieves, you know.”
Indeed, there were too many thieves in the country.
“You must be tired from your long journey. Please have a drink.”
Kim Cheolung took the drink and stared at Woojin.
No, he opened his mouth.
“Why on earth did you become an Officer?”
“I wanted to try it.”
“That ‘I want to do it’ thing, really… Why an Officer of all things?”
“Officers are closer to the citizens than plainclothes Police or Prosecutors, aren’t they?”
Kim Cheolung let out a small laugh.
It was because Woojin’s words were hitting a certain righteous path.
“Officers move faster?”
“Yes.”
“Officers don’t have investigative powers, do they?”
“But they have connections with investigative powers, don’t they?”
The connections Woojin was referring to were none other than Kim Cheolung.
Kim Cheolung, who had become a National Assembly Member with enthusiastic public support, was steadily expanding his network of relationships.
There were also some Prosecutors, and even rookie Prosecutors who respected Prosecutor Kim Cheolung.
And there was also Lee Hyerim.
A year ago, Chairman Lee Jeongmun had become reclusive, and Lee Hyerim was acting as his spokesperson, filling the void.
The media was buzzing that a successor to the Shinhwa Group might emerge, skipping a generation.
She also had deep connections with political figures.
At Woojin’s words, Kim Cheolung smiled and nodded.
He himself had risen to stardom and become an Assemblyman thanks to Woojin, but Lee Hyerim had become a complete powerhouse.
The connections Woojin was pointing to were enough to make one nod in agreement.
“All I have to do is catch it.”
Kim Cheolung downed the Soju coolly.
Then he slammed the Soju glass down!
“It’s a waste, you know. He’s too skilled to be rotting away in a place like this.”
Doesn’t he also possess the skill to solve an Unsolved Case that’s decades old in one go?
In Kim Cheolung’s opinion, Woojin was a tiger trapped on an island.
He couldn’t shake the feeling that this guy, who should be spreading his wings and roaming freely, was just circling around on an island.
Just then, a newly arrived customer approached.
It was a man who appeared to be in his late 50s.
“Officer Shin, what brings you here?”
“Hello. It’s a famous Samgyeopsal restaurant, isn’t it? Are the mushrooms growing well?”
“Don’t even get me started! It’s incredible how well they’re growing! And it’s so convenient. Thank you so much.”
It was Woojin who had provided the Brain Food equipment for free.
The machine determined and maintained the temperature and humidity, and these could even be checked on a Cellphone.
It was a system that increased yield and significantly reduced labor by creating an optimal Environment.
Woojin didn’t help just anyone.
He helped diligent people, kind-hearted people, those who knew how to share, those who knew how to be grateful, and despite all this, those who were suffering from financial hardship.
He was helping such people.
Money?
He had enough money.
Brain Food had merged with J&R Future, founded by Lee Hyerim, and J&R Future had grown even larger and once again bore the name of Shinhwa Group.
And Woojin was its Largest Shareholder.
Not only that, he also held a suitable amount of shares, which were Shinhwa Group’s treasury stocks.
“It’s unlikely, but if the temperature or humidity isn’t adjusting, please contact us. The Service Center Staff Members will be right over.”
“What am I going to do, just keep receiving like this? Thank you so much.”
“Then please make Mushroom Barley Bibimbap for me again sometime. It was really delicious.”
“I stop by every lunchtime. I’m just so good at it… No, I’ll sell it and half the profit…”
Woojin smiled subtly, cutting him off.
“Mushroom Barley Bibimbap, that’s enough.”
Woojin often visited the homes he was helping like this to have lunch.
It was partly for observation, and he liked how their smiling faces seemed to fill his heart with warmth.
He liked how they were becoming more peaceful.
Just then, Woojin received a call, so he said goodbye to him.
“Then I’ll see you next time.”
“Alright. Have a good time~”
As Woojin brought his cellphone to his ear, Kim Cheolung shook his head in disbelief.
It seems he even does volunteer work separately…
The officer even spends his own money to help people.
“Hello.”
-It’s me, your older brother, Woojin. Are you sleeping?
It was Detective Kim Taehyun.
“No. I was drinking pork belly with soju. With Assemblyman Kim Cheolung.”
-Huh? With whom?
“With Assemblyman Kim Cheolung.”
-…Woojin, I’m hurt.
“Huh?”
-You said you were busy lately… You said you couldn’t make time, but you canceled our plans…
Kim Taehyun felt as if Assemblyman Kim Cheolung had stolen Woojin from him.
“Detective Kim, have you been drinking? Assemblyman Kim Cheolung came here abusing his authority. I’m the victim.”
-So he came without contacting you? Let me talk to him.
“Just a moment.”
Woojin immediately handed the cellphone to Kim Cheolung.
“Oh my, long time no see, Detective Kim.”
-Assemblyman, you shouldn’t just show up when our Woojin is busy.
Kim Cheolung chuckled.
“Then Detective Kim, you should come find me too.”
Kim Cheolung opened his mouth playfully again.
“Our Woojin? He’s my Woojin~~!”
-What did you say?
“He’s my Woojin~!”
Then he handed the cellphone back to Woojin.
-That old man seems drunk?
“He hasn’t even had one bottle yet.”
-People say they’re busy, but Assemblyman Ira just shows up. Woojin, make some time. We should meet, shouldn’t we?
“Yes.”
-Don’t just say yes, actually make time.
“Yes.”
-Alright, I’ll call you again. Enjoy your meal.
After finishing the call, Woojin looked at Assemblyman Kim Cheolung again.
He was looking at him with a smile, arms crossed.
His eyes were not looking directly at him, but slightly wavering.
Smiling, thinking about the past and imagining, with his arms crossed, means…
There’s a very high probability that he’s making a plan.
Woojin held out his glass.
“Assemblyman Kim Cheolung, I’m fine as I am.”
Kim Cheolung nodded and clinked glasses.
“Of course you are.”

The next day.
Woojin gave his statement about yesterday’s events at the Police Station.
The Detective who heard Woojin’s statement couldn’t help but be a little surprised.
His ability to determine the time of death, the weapon used, and the perpetrator’s actions by examining the kitchen at the crime scene, as well as the bloodstains and footprints in the warehouse, was a Righteous Path that made one gasp in admiration.
It automatically brought to mind detective stories from movies and dramas.
It was a fresh shock to realize an Officer possessed such intelligence.
And Woojin emphasized that the Criminal resisted and was cut by a knife.
This was to add more charges.
Also, Assemblyman Kim Cheolung’s influence would separately come into play.
Since Woojin had already informed him.
After finishing his statement, Woojin headed to the Elementary School instead of returning in a Police Car.
The Police Car was parked far away from the Elementary School, and he changed into different clothes so as not to look like a Police Officer.
Then he walked to his favorite Snack Bar.
It was about time for the children to start leaving school.
“You’re here again?”
“Yes. The Tteokbokki is so delicious. Just one serving, please.”
Soon, steaming Tteokbokki came out, and Woojin began eating it while standing outside.
The taste was excellent when eaten with the thickly sliced green onions.
Indeed, it seemed that Tteokbokki truly revealed its value when eaten in front of an Elementary School.
He also took a paper cup of Fish Cake Broth and brought it to his lips.
As he did so, Woojin’s eyes began to scan his surroundings.
There was only one reason why Woojin had been frequenting the Elementary School’s Snack Bar these days.
It was because something had caught his eye.
